Overrogue is a new card deck-building roguelite from KEMCO

-

overrogue

KEMCO are well known in these parts for creating some lovely old-school fantasy adventures. In fact, over the years they’ve thrown out a host of those exact games to Xbox, PlayStation, PC and Switch. Today though they are going for something a little different – Overrogue is a card deck-builder which mixes in some roguelite action. 

Don’t get worries, from what we’ve seen and played this is a typical KEMCO experience; it’s just they are trying to infuse something slightly different into the experience as a whole. 

Having features on the Summer Game Fest Demo scene, it’s now time for the full game to rock up onto Xbox One, Xbox Series X|S, PS4, PS5, Nintendo Switch and PC. Priced at £12.49, Overrogue is a game in which you are thrust into the underworld; a realm in which many creatures roam. It’s also a place that is looking for its next Overlord. Step forward. 

In Overrogue you’ll be tasked with making your way through a number of labyrinths, all dungeon-styled and ready for reaping. It’s here where you’ll get to utilise a number of card decks, working some roguelite elements in hope of building up the deck you need for success. There are more than 300 cards in place and upwards of 150 drops of treasure to enjoy, and so the combinations that are allowed in Overrogue are seemingly plentiful. 

The only real question that awaits is whether or not you have what it takes to conquer the labyrinths and become the Overlord you’ve always thought of yourself as.

Game Description:

In the underworld, where creatures of all shapes and sizes live, a Selection Battle is announced to decide the next Overlord. Complete labyrinths and collect crystals to achieve the title of Overlord! Proceed through dungeon-like labyrinths building up your card deck in a roguelite style! There are up to 5 different labyrinth themes based on card genres like poison or graveyards. Enjoy a different deck experience each time you visit the labyrinth as the number of cards increases. Over 300 types of cards and 150 types of treasure await you, so combos and combinations are up to you. Let’s conquer the labyrinths and become the next Overlord!
